What hardware do I need to transform my laptop into an HDMI monitor?
To transform your laptop into an HDMI monitor, you will need a few essential pieces of hardware. Primarily, you require an HDMI capture card that can connect to your laptop’s USB port, as laptops typically do not have HDMI input ports. Additionally, you will need an appropriate HDMI cable to link your main device (such as a gaming console or another computer) to the capture card.
It’s also recommended to have video capture software installed on your laptop to facilitate the display of the input signal. Options like OBS Studio are popular choices, as they are user-friendly and support various input configurations. Lastly, ensure that your laptop meets the necessary hardware specifications so that it can effectively process the incoming video signal without significant lag.
Can I use software solutions to achieve this task?
Yes, software solutions are available that can help you use your laptop as an HDMI display. Applications such as SpaceDesk or Duet Display allow you to extend or mirror your primary screen onto your laptop’s display over a network connection. These applications are especially useful for users who prefer wireless setups and want to provide additional functionality without the complexity of hardware modifications.
Keep in mind, however, that while software solutions can be highly effective, they often come with certain limitations regarding refresh rates and resolution. The quality of the video signal may vary based on your network bandwidth and the capabilities of the software you are using. For the best results, it’s advisable to run these applications on a robust network with minimal interference.
Is there any difference between using a capture card and software solutions?
Yes, there are notable differences between using a capture card and software solutions when transforming your laptop into an HDMI monitor. A capture card typically offers more robust performance in terms of video quality and latency, as it directly captures and processes HDMI input. This method is particularly advantageous for gamers or professionals who require high-resolution video and seamless performance during live broadcasts or gameplay.
On the other hand, software solutions are usually more convenient and easier to set up, especially for casual users who need basic mirroring or extended display functionality. While they may suffice for less demanding applications, users may experience some lag and reduced quality compared to a dedicated capture card setup. Ultimately, the choice between the two methods hinges on your specific needs and the intended use of your laptop as a monitor.

Are there any performance issues I should be aware of?
Performance issues can arise when using a laptop as an HDMI monitor, particularly regarding lag and resolution limitations. When using a capture card, the latency can vary based on the quality and specifications of the card used. Lesser-quality capture cards may introduce noticeable delays, which could be a concern for gamers or professionals relying on real-time feedback. It’s important to choose a reputable capture card designed for low-latency applications to reduce such issues.
Similarly, when utilizing software-based solutions, performance may depend significantly on your laptop’s hardware, network stability, and the capabilities of the applications you’re using. Users may experience frame drops, latency issues, or reduced image quality when bandwidth or processing power is inadequate. Therefore, assessing your laptop’s specifications and ensuring a stable network setup is crucial for optimal performance.

What limitations should I be aware of when using a laptop as an HDMI monitor?
There are several limitations to consider when using a laptop as an HDMI monitor. The most significant limitation is the potential latency or lag experienced, particularly with software solutions that rely on network connections. Even with a wired capture card, latency can still occur, especially if the system is not powerful enough to handle the processing demands of real-time video. This can impact tasks requiring immediate feedback, such as gaming or design work.
Additionally, resolution and refresh rate limitations may arise based on your laptop’s display capabilities and the output characteristics of the device you’re connecting it to. Not all laptops can handle high-resolution inputs or maintain optimal refresh rates, which might lead to a less than desirable display experience. Evaluating these limitations can guide your decision on whether to use your laptop as an HDMI monitor for specific tasks.
